misappropriate
mis|ap|pro|pri|ate /m'ɪsəpr'oʊprieɪt/ (misappropriates misappropriating misappropriated)
[VERB] V n
If someone misappropriates money which does not belong to them, they take it without permission and use it for their own purposes.
I took no money for personal use and have not misappropriated any funds whatsoever...
● misappropriation [N-UNCOUNT] usu N of n
He pleaded guilty to charges of misappropriation of bank funds.
